Eligibility criteria
You must have:
Required academic qualification:
- A Ph.D. degree in public economics.
- Relevant experience in teaching.
- Fluency in spoken and written English skills.
Desired qualifications:
- Experience with publishing in academic journals.
- Previous research experience in public economics, preferably on tax issues.
- Proficiency in a Scandinavian language (Norwegian, Danish or Swedish).
- Insights into the institutional structures of Norwegian and other tax systems, as well as property and financial markets.
- Ability to access and use administrative register data, and, preferably, utilize open source data.
Required personal qualifications:
- Excellent communication skills.
Desired personal qualifications:
- Experience with coordinating international teams working on data.
- Ability to develop research ideas at the research frontier.
- Ability to work independently and under time pressure.
- Ability to contribute to a good atmosphere within the research group.
About the Norwegian University of Life Sciences:
The School of Economics and Business is one of seven faculties at NMBU. Its mission is to create knowledge across the fields of economics and business administration and to develop professionals and leaders who combine an economic mindset with multidisciplinary knowledge equipped to address real-world problems with sustainability.
